About Converting Fluid ounce per Weeks to Deciliters per Fortnight

Fluid ounce per Weeks and Deciliter per Fortnight both measure volumetric flow rate — how much volume passes a point over time — used to size pipes and pumps, monitor river or stream discharge, control industrial processes, and set medical infusion rates. Both are volumetric flow rate units.

Formula

deciliters per fortnight = fluid ounce per weeks × 0.59147059125

This factor comes from each unit's defined relationship to the category's base unit: 1 fluid ounce per weeks equals 4.889803e-11 base units, and 1 deciliter per fortnight equals 8.267196e-11 base units, so dividing one by the other gives the direct fluid ounce per weeks-to-deciliter per fortnight factor of 0.59147059125.

What's the difference between volumetric and mass flow rate?

Volumetric flow rate measures the volume of fluid passing a point per unit time (for example, liters per second). Mass flow rate measures the mass instead. For a fluid of constant density the two are directly proportional, but for compressible fluids like gases, mass flow is often the more meaningful quantity.
